Calculate the pip value, position size, and dollar risk for the USD/CHF forex pair. Because USD is the base currency, USD/CHF pip value in USD depends on the current rate. USD/CHF Pip Value Reference (at ~0.8700)

Lot size Units Pip value (USD) 10-pip move
Standard (1.0) 100,000 ~$11.49 ~$114.94
Mini (0.1) 10,000 ~$1.149 ~$11.49
Micro (0.01) 1,000 ~$0.1149 ~$1.149

Worked Example: $50 Risk on USD/CHF

$50 risk, 25-pip stop, pip value $11.49/lot.
$50 ÷ (25 × $11.49) = 0.174 lots.

USD/CHF Calculator FAQ

What is the pip value of USD/CHF?
It depends on your lot size. On a standard lot (100,000 units), the pip value is fixed if USD is the quote currency, or varies with the current rate if it isn't. See the reference table above.
Is USD/CHF good for beginners?
USD/CHF is highly liquid with tight spreads and reasonable daily ranges, generally suitable for new traders.
How many pips does USD/CHF usually move per day?
USD/CHF typical daily range is 80-150 pips for the average session, with wider ranges around major news. Always check the current ATR (Average True Range) on your timeframe.
What time of day is USD/CHF most active?
USD/CHF is most active during the London-New York session overlap (13:00-17:00 UTC).
